Steve Jones (footballer, born 1960)


Steve Francis Jones is an English former footballer who played as a midfielder. He started his professional career with Manchester United before moving to Port Vale.

Playing career

Jones was signed by Manchester United, but did not make a senior first team appearance for the "Red Devils" before joining Port Vale in July 1979. He played sixteen games in 1979–80, scoring his first senior goal in a final day 3–0 win over Doncaster Rovers at Vale Park, as the "Valiants" finished 20th in the Fourth Division. He opened the 1980–81 season with a goal, in another 3–0 home win over Doncaster Rovers, but went on to suffer a broken collarbone and finished the season with fourteen appearances to his name. He left Vale by mutual consent in June 1981, having played 30 games in league and cup competitions.
